Mr. Derbert D. Mooney, Sr., age 85, of Hawkins, passed away on Friday, September 14, 2018 at his home. Derbert was born at home in Upshur County on October 24, 1932 to the late John Prescott "J.P." Mooney and Mary Lou (Dunaway) Mooney. Derbert enlisted in the U.S. Navy in 1952, and served honorably as a ship engineer, for 21 years, including multiple campaigns during the Korean and Vietnam Wars, retiring as Chief Warrant Officer-II in 1973. He then went to work for Tyler Pipe as a machine maintenance supervisor, retiring after 20 years. He was a member of the Holly Brook Baptist Church in Hawkins.
